Year in review Directors’ Report Financial Statements Remuneration Report Sustainability Our Leaders 29 Annual Report 2021 | REA Group Ltd Tracey Fellows BEc Non-executive Director Appointed Executive Director and Chief Executive Officer 20 August 2014 until 25 January 2019, before becoming a non-executive Director on 26 January 2019. Age 56. Independent: No – Nominee Director of News Corp Australia and former Chief Executive Officer. Skills and experience: Ms Fellows is a digital media executive with extensive experience in real estate, technology and communications across Australian and international markets. Ms Fellows is President of Global Digital Real Estate for News Corp, responsible for driving the strategy and growth of its digital real estate interests. Ms Fellows was previously the Chief Executive Officer of REA Group where she drove the rapid expansion of the digital real estate business in Australia and Asia, as well as leading the company’s investments in India and North America. She has also held the positions of Executive General Manager of Communication Management Services at Australia Post, President, Asia Pacific at Microsoft and Chief Executive Officer of Microsoft Australia. Directorships of listed entities, current and recent (last three years): – Director of Hemnet Group AB (since November 2020) Board Committee membership: – Ms Fellows attends all Human Resources Committee meetings at the invitation of the Board/Committee. Richard J Freudenstein BEc, LLB (Hons) Non-executive Director Appointed 21 November 2006 (Chairman from 2007 to 2012). Age 56. Independent: No – Nominee Director of News Corp Australia. Skills and experience: Mr Freudenstein is a former media executive with extensive experience in Australian and international markets. He was Chief Executive Officer of Foxtel from 2011 to 2016, and previously CEO of News Digital Media (the digital division of News Limited) and The Australian newspaper. Mr Freudenstein was previously the Chief Operating Officer of British Sky Broadcasting. Directorships of listed entities, current and recent (last three years): – Director of Coles Group Limited (since November 2018) – Director Astro Malaysia Holdings Berhad (from September 2016 to August 2019) Board Committee membership: – Member of the Audit, Risk & Compliance Committee – Member of the Human Resources Committee. Alternate Director: Marygrace DeGrazio (age 45) was appointed an Alternate Director for Richard J Freudenstein on 5 May 2020. Ms DeGrazio has not attended any meetings or exercised any powers in that capacity since that time. Ms DeGrazio is currently the Senior Vice President, Global Financial Operations at News Corp responsible for global accounting and financial reporting. Prior to joining News Corp, she spent 15 years in the audit practice of PricewaterhouseCoopers servicing entertainment and media clients. Independent: No – Nominee Director of News Corp Australia. Skills and experience: Mr Miller was appointed Executive Chairman Australasia of News Corp Australia in November 2015. He has over 25 years’ experience working in senior executive roles in the media industry, most recently as the CEO of APN News and Media (now HT&E). Mr Miller was previously the Regional Director for News Limited in New South Wales, the Managing Director of Advertiser News Media in South Australia, and News Limited’s Group Marketing Director. Directorships of listed entities, current and recent (last three years): n/a Board Committee membership: n/a Jennifer Lambert BBus, MEc, CA, FAICD Independent non-executive Director Appointed 1 December 2020. Age 54. Skills and experience: Ms Lambert has extensive business and leadership experience at the senior executive and board level with more than 25 years of financial management and accounting experience, including over 15 years specialising in the property industry. Ms Lambert was CFO at Valad then 151 Property for 13 years, and prior to this was a director at PwC specialising in audit, capital raisings and acquisitions and disposals. Directorships of listed entities, current and recent (last three years): – Director of BlueScope Steel Limited (since September 2017) – Director of NEXTDC Limited (since October 2019) Board Committee membership: – Chair of the Audit, Risk & Compliance Committee – Member of the Human Resources Committee
